The Band
Formed in the summer of 2008, Opal Creek has been electrifying audiences with their hot, spicy bluegrass tunes. They can be heard playing solid and lively traditional songs as well as originals they've thrown in the mix.
Robin Carl
Banjo, Lead and Harmony Vocals
Robin started playing music when she was young (you should have heard her rock out on the recorder in grade school!). She later moved on to piano but broke her teacher's heart when she found her true calling... the Tuba. Thus began her love affair with unusual instruments.
Tanya Bunson
Fiddle
Tanya was first introduced to the violin at age 6. In college she realized that her violin could double up as a fiddle and a whole new world of musical possibilities opened up before her. She has delved into a plethora of musical styles including Klezmer, Irish, Indian, and of course bluegrass. Tanya considers herself a non-traditionalist and is always looking for creative ways to add a bit of hot, sizzling, spicy fiddle to the mix.
Sheri Lynn
Mandolin, Lead and Harmony Vocals
Born and raised in upstate NY, Sheri's introduction to bluegrass music came at an early age while listening to her dad's "Will the Circle be Unbroken" and "Old and In the Way" records. She has been playing guitar and mandolin for over 10 years and in addition to playing with Opal Creek, she plays with her husband in The Lynn Family Bluegrass Band.
Chelsea Mattson
Guitar, Lead and Harmony Vocals
Chelsea decided at a young age that she would learn to play as many musical instruments as possible and dabbled in playing the piano, harmonica, cello, trumpet, drums and saxophone before discovering the acoustic guitar. At 13 she began focusing her musical ambitions toward becoming an electric guitarist in a famous rock band until she realized that she found acoustic music much more appealing.
Michael Bray
Stand-up Bass, Vocals
With a grandpa on banjo, a dad on guitar and a brother who sings, there was no escaping it, Mike was bound to be a musician. After first exploring the trumpet and guitar, Mike found his passion playing the bass. He has toured all over N. America and Europe pleasing audiences with his electric and stand-up bass and his vocal back ups. He toured with country artist "Alexis" opening for such acts as Keith Urban and Le Anne Rimes. Now he's home in Eugene playing bluegrass with The Green Mountain Bluegrass Band and the sassiest, grassiest band in town......Opal Creek.
